A Call to Prayer on the Fifth Anniversary of the Tree of Life Massacre

This past Sunday, 20 representatives from a variety of faith traditions, gathered along with over a hundred worshipers at St. Paul’s Cathedral in Oakland. The service recognized the fifth anniversary of the Tree of Life mass shooting, which occurred on October 27, 2018. In this week’s letter, Rev. Brian Wallace asks us to take time to pray for those impacted by what happened at Tree of Life five years ago, and to pray for the end of hatred and violence in our world.

Vietnam Mission Vision Trip – April 18-27

Our purpose is to learn from and be inspired by Christians in Vietnam through involvement with numerous brothers and sisters in Christ. We will engage with various ministries, including the Presbyterian Church, Bible Society, UUC seminary, campus ministry, media ministry, and an Unreached People Group, to listen, pray with, and encourage them. There is an option for a 7-day Mekong River cruise prior to the vision trip. For more information contact Don Dawson at dawsondonj@gmail.com.
